Sebastian Navarrro (BS Chemistry-University of Calgary, AB)
Successfully completed an 8-week Internship Program at Hallmark Laboratories Inc. During the internship, he gained hands-on experience in the operation, calibration, and maintenance of a variety of advanced analytical instruments, including High-Performance Liquid Chromatography (HPLC), Inductively Coupled Plasma Optical Emission Spectroscopy (ICP-OES), UV-Visible Spectrophotometry (UV-Vis), and Gas Chromatography-Mass Selective Detection (GC-MSD).
He demonstrated the ability to independently perform instrument calibration, sample preparation, method execution, data acquisition, and preliminary data interpretation while adhering to laboratory quality and safety procedures. In addition, he actively participated in laboratory operations by organizing and managing laboratory inventory, maintaining equipment records, preparing reagents and standards, and assisting with routine preventive maintenance and troubleshooting of analytical instruments.
